I normally don’t post any out of town restaurants on here. But I felt you guys needed to know about Murray’s. I drove to Anniston, AL a few days ago and stopped for a quick lunch in Carrolton. My friend Docksocks owns The Carrolton Menu, a blog about the city and that’s where I found out about Murray’s. It’s a meat-and-two cafeteria where everything on the menu is prepared fresh each day using only the best ingredients.

Located in the middle of downtown, this dimly-lit joint was bustling with a good-sized lunch crowd when we came in. The grandma/chef is as sweet as any southern grandma can be. And she makes everything from scratch. Using fresh ingredients. Not canned! And while almost all meat-and-two places showcase only the meat part, this place have the best tasting sides ever.
Clik here to view.

All I can say is that this is the best southern food I’ve ever had. They have juicy, tender, flavorful meats. And forget bland, mushy sides. Here, they are outstanding — so tasty — that this is the only place that could turn me into a vegetarian. Seriously, I never knew greens could taste so good and so different. They also have this chicken dressing that was to-die-for.
Carrollton is less than an hour west of Atlanta almost to the border of Alabama. Stop by if you can. Or make a trip out of it. It’s that good. Oh and since you’re already gonna be in the area, check out the Barber Motorsports Museum in Leeds, AL. The motorcycle museum will blow you away.
